From 4c5ee23e4fda77fd895c7acd0a3eb19d6ad2a07f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dylan de Heer Date: Mon, 3 Aug 2026 22:59:26 +0200 Subject: [PATCH 1/2] Add optional heading typeface and heading text color M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it The theme can recolor every element except heading text (it inherits bodyText), and the heading config covers every metric except the face — so an embedder that wants serif display headings over a sans body has to fork. HeadingStyle.fontName picks a PostScript face for headings, honored exactly so the chosen weight survives; an unresolvable name falls back to the stock bold base font, like TaskCheckboxStyle's symbol fallback. MarkdownEditorTheme.headingText colors heading text while the `#` glyphs stay on headingMarker and inline constructs inside a heading keep their own ink. Emphasis inside a heading still composes on top of the configured face (traits added, family and per-level size kept). Both knobs default to nil, which keeps styling identical to before.
